They are ruminant animals, so their digestive system is pretty different from ours. Like cattle, goats, elk, and deer, sheep have four stomach chambers. Sheep are ruminants. Their unique digestive tract helps them pull nutrients out of grasses and other forage that many other mammals’ stomachs can’t do. Like goats and cows, sheep shouldn’t eat the same types of foods that humans, dogs, or cats can eat. In addition to pumpkins, sheep can eat all types of squashes. This includes acorn squash, zucchini, winter squash, butternut, summer squash, and blue hubbard.
